Output 57c99aa637ebf27d722e0824b48c81b25ad730cef8292464ef6170582691a55e:1

value
324139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b4c66abba72d44797d45b5e462a291011dc39b1 OP_EQUALVERIFY OP_CHECKSIG
address
16QYPkt4dyWdZARcAnD57GjxpekQn4oPWq
transaction
57c99aa637ebf27d722e0824b48c81b25ad730cef8292464ef6170582691a55e
confirmations
188227
spent
true